WebFeb 12, 2024 · 저 is a polite form of 나. There's no reason for explicit "너" (or "당신") to denote "you": after all, the question only makes sense as "do you know me?". In fact, using even 당신 would make the sentence sound more rude. (Modern Korean doesn't really have a good polite form for singular "you".) 아세요 is made of 알- "know (알다 ... WebAug 24, 2024 · The most common way to say "thank you" in Korean is 감사합니다 (gam-sa-ham-ni-da). While this phrase is considered polite and formal, it's appropriate in any situation when you're speaking to a stranger. There are other more informal ways to say "thank you" in Korean to friends and family members. WebIt's actually quite a clever particle if you think about it. Instead of saying different ones like: "I go by bus" or "I say it in Korean" or even "It's made of ___ ingredients", you can just use "로". In essence, what you really mean is that you go through the means of ABC to acheive XYZ, so all you need is "ABC로 XYZ.". It's quite clever, I ... WebJun 21, 2024 · Basic Korean greetings and expressions. 1. Annyeonghaseyo (안녕하세요) – “Hello”. Let’s start with the basics of saying “hello” and “thank you” in Korean. Koreans greet each other by saying, “Annyeonghaseyo (안녕하세요). ” You say this while slightly nodding your head if the person is around the same age as you.

WebSep 2, 2024 · 1. Say 안녕하세요 (an-nyeong-ha-se-yo) when meeting someone for the first time. If you're an adult and you're talking to someone you don't know, 안녕하세요 (an-nyeong-ha-se-yo) is your best choice to say "hello."
